Abstract

The invention relates to a method and a device for removing paint mist, catering waste gas and oil mist with an automatic cleaning function. The method comprises steps of using a slewing mechanism to rotate the filter material, locating the filter material at a gas processing area, a liquid cleaning area and a gas back-flushing area in order, and separating the paint mist, catering waste gas and oil mist adhered on the filter vat from the filter material through cleaning liquid and an ultrasonic generator. The device comprises a filter vat and a high-pressure fan. The filter material is mounted on the filter vat that is divided into three fan-shaped areas by separating plates, including a gas processing area, a liquid cleaning area and a gas back-flushing area, wherein the liquid cleaning area is not communicated with the gas back-flushing area and gas to be processed in the gas processing area; and cleaning liquid is filled in the liquid cleaning area; an ultrasonic generator is mounted in the cleaning liquid. The high-pressure fan is placed in an outer cavity of a concentric cylinder. The device is high in purification efficiency. The filter material can not block the device easily, so that the device can be operated continuously.

Background technology
Along with the increase of environmental consciousness, people can constantly be the waste gas of strengthening handling spraying process and the generation of cooking process.
The exhaust gas constituents that painting process produces mainly comprises: (1) paint mist, and (2) toluene, xylenes etc. are used for the organic solvent of Paint dilution; The main component of food and drink waste gas mainly comprises: (1) is because the small mist of oil that edible oil produces in heating process; (2) food processing process is owing to the solid-state molecule of rice Maillard reaction generation, gaseous organic substance matter such as (3) aldehydes, ketone, hydro carbons, alcohols, fatty acid.
Because contained paint mist or mist of oil can stop up waste gas treatment equipment in lacquer spraying waste gas and the food and drink waste gas, so separating oil coating cloud, mist of oil are important to effective processing lacquer spraying waste gas and food and drink waste gas ten minutes from lacquer spraying waste gas, food and drink waste gas.
At present, domestic is to take filtration method separating oil coating cloud or mist of oil basically.Filtration method is to adopt oil loving polymer composite (active carbon, nonwoven, sponge and ball-type filtering material) etc.; Mist of oil, particulate pollutant in oil in the lacquer spraying waste gas seven mist or the food and drink waste gas are retained down; This purification method possesses the high advantage of purification efficiency, and still along with the growth of running time, filtering material easy blocking, filter pressure increase; Need periodic replacement or cleaning and filtering material; Troublesome maintenance, operating cost height, power of fan is big, is easy to generate pollutions such as noise.
Summary of the invention
The objective of the invention is to problem and shortage, provide a kind of purification efficiency height, filtering material to be not easy to stop up automatic oil removing coating cloud, food and drink waste gas mist of oil method and the device that cleans of the band that to work continuously to above-mentioned existence.
Above-mentioned purpose of the present invention is to be achieved through following technical scheme:
Oil removing coating cloud, food and drink waste gas mist of oil method that band cleans automatically comprise the steps:
(1) utilize blower fan pending gas to be blown into the gas treatment district of filter vat;
(2) in the gas treatment district, utilize paint mist, food and drink waste gas mist of oil in the filtering material filtering gas, can directly discharge after the gas filtration;
(3) utilize rotating mechanism will absorb the filtering material that paints mist, food and drink waste gas mist of oil and change the liquid cleaning area over to; In the liquid cleaning area, cleaning fluid is housed; Filtering material is immersed in the cleaning fluid; Ultrasonic generator has been installed in the cleaning fluid, has been utilized cleaning fluid and ultrasonic generator to separate from filtering material attached to the paint mist on the filter vat, food and drink waste gas mist of oil;
(4) utilize the filtering material after rotating mechanism will clean to change the blow-back district over to, utilize blower fan to blow away the cleaning fluid on the filtering material;
(5) utilize rotating mechanism to change clean filtering material over to the gas treatment district, repeating step 2, so circulation.
Use automatic oil removing coating cloud, the food and drink waste gas mist of oil device that cleans of band of the inventive method, comprise filter vat, high pressure positive blower, filter material apparatus is on filter vat; Filter vat is the concentric column structure, and length can be long arbitrarily, and filter vat radially is divided into three sector regions by dividing plate; Be respectively the gas treatment district, the liquid cleaning area is isolated with the blow-back district; Wherein the liquid cleaning area is not communicated with the pending gas that gets into the gas treatment district with the blow-back district, and filter vat is under the drive of rotating mechanism, in regular turn through gas treatment district, liquid cleaning area and blow-back district; In the liquid cleaning area, cleaning fluid is housed, ultrasonic generator has been installed in the cleaning fluid.
High pressure positive blower places the exocoel of concentric cylinder, and the liquid cleaning area can be communicated with and can not be communicated with the blow-back district, and when the liquid cleaning area was communicated with the blow-back district, the cleaning fluid that is blown off by high pressure positive blower can get into recycle in the liquid cleaning area.
Filtering material can be stainless steel cloth, active carbon, sponge, nonwoven or spherical filtering material.
The present invention adopts method as described above and device; Method and apparatus is in the past compared, and the present invention is equipped with cleaning fluid owing to be provided with the liquid cleaning area at the liquid cleaning area; Ultrasonic generator has been installed in the cleaning fluid; Filtering material is immersed in the cleaning fluid, utilizes cleaning fluid and ultrasonic generator from filtering material, well to separate attached to the paint mist on the filter vat, food and drink waste gas mist of oil, can not cause filtering material to stop up; Filter vat is the concentric column structure, and length can be long arbitrarily, and filter area can be infinitely great, and filtration resistance has only 10%-20% of traditional filtering device; High pressure positive blower places the exocoel of concentric cylinder; When the liquid cleaning area was communicated with the blow-back district, the cleaning fluid that is blown off by high pressure positive blower can get into recycle in the liquid cleaning area, saved the energy; Filter vat is the concentric column structure; Filtering material remains clean state, can work continuously, and is in high purification efficiency state for a long time.
